DataFrame.iloc选择DataFrame数据结构的行和列。 DataFrame.iloc[0:2,0:3]; 表示该数据结构0:2,0-2行; 表示该数据结构0:3,0-3列; 因此读取数据结构的0-2行已经0-3列。 通过该函数对数据进行切片。python3的切片方法不适用于datafr ...
转载
2021-07-27 19:32:00
167阅读
2评论
# 使用Python的DataFrame iloc方法循环遍历数据
在数据处理和分析过程中,经常需要遍历DataFrame中的数据进行操作。Python的pandas库提供了多种方法来实现这一目的,其中`iloc`方法是一种常用的方式。`iloc`方法允许我们按照位置来访问DataFrame中的数据,从而方便地进行循环操作。
在本文中,我们将介绍如何使用`iloc`方法循环遍历DataFram
原创
2024-03-27 04:11:27
234阅读
官网资料:
loc :https://pandas.pydata.org/pandas-docs/stable/reference/api/pandas.DataFrame.loc.htmliloc : https://pandas.pydata.org/pandas-docs/stable/reference/api/pandas.DataFrame.iloc.ht
转载
2023-11-13 09:10:14
138阅读
最近接触到数据科学,需要对一些数据表进行分析,观察到代码中一会出现loc一会又出现iloc,下面对两者的用法给出我的一些理解。1.联系(1)操作对象相同:loc和iloc都是对DataFrame类型进行操作;(2)完成目的相同:二者都是用于选取DataFrame中对应行或列中的元素。2.区别loc和iloc索引的行列标签类型不同。iloc使用顺序数字来索引数据,而不能使用字符型的标签来索引数据;注
转载
2023-08-20 19:59:37
598阅读
文章目录条件筛选单条件筛选多条件筛选排除特定行索引筛选切片操作loc函数ilocix函数at函数iat函数 众所周知pandas的DataFrame数据结构提供了功能强大的数据操作功能,例如运算,筛选,统计等。 今天我们就来谈一谈其强大的数据筛选功能,主要包括两大类,按照条件筛选和按照索引筛选。可以对
转载
2022-02-23 17:08:38
967阅读
文章目录条件筛选单条件筛选多条件筛选排除特定行索引筛选切片操作loc函数ilocix函数at函数iat函数众所周知pandas的DataFrame数据结构提供了功能强大的数据操作功能,例如运算,筛选,统计等。今天我们就来谈一谈其强大的数据筛选功能,主要包括两大类,按照条件筛选和按照索引筛选。可以对行进行筛选,也可以按照列进行筛选。import numpy as npimport panda...
原创
2021-06-18 16:21:44
864阅读
DataFrame基础之loc和iloc的区别。
原创
2022-06-09 07:05:43
8279阅读
点赞
一、为什么学习pandasnumpy已经可以帮助我们进行数据的处理了,那么学习pandas的目的是什么呢?
numpy能够帮助我们处理的是数值型的数据,当然在数据分析中除了数值型的数据还有好多其他类型的数据(字符串,时间序列),那么pandas就可以帮我们很好的处理除了数值型的其他数据!二、什么是pandas?首先先来认识pandas中的两个常用的类
SeriesDataFrame1.
转载
2023-12-22 19:27:10
181阅读
#本数据纯属虚构,如有雷同实属巧合本次拜读的是: 目录创建读取 使用loc索引读取dataframe:使用iloc读取数据表格dataframe""" dataframe是python数据分析基础中的核心, 这位按字面意义可理解为数据表格、数据框架, 她跟excel的table很相似, 由三部分组成: 行索引,称为index; 列索引,称为column; 数据内容。
转载
2024-04-26 21:14:52
361阅读
Pandas——ix vs loc vs iloc区别
0. DataFrame
DataFrame 的构造主要依赖如下三个参数:
data:表格数据;
index:行索引;
columns:列名; index 对行进行索引,columns 对列进行索引;
import pandas as pd
data = [[1,2,3],[4,5,6]]
index = [0,1]
co
转载
2018-04-27 22:04:00
232阅读
2评论
Pandas是基于NumPy 的一种工具,该工具是为了解决数据分析任务而创建的。
转载
2022-06-02 06:29:30
283阅读
Pandas DataFrame切片操作在本文中,我们将介绍如何使用Pandas切片操作将一个DataFrame切片成一个新的DataFrame。什么是切片操作?切片操作是指通过选择某个数据结构的一部分来创建一个新的数据结构的过程。在Pandas中,DataFrame是一个二维数据结构,类似于表格,可以通过切片操作来选择特定的行和列,以创建一个新的DataFrame。切片操作的语法Pandas提供
转载
2024-10-25 17:29:51
68阅读
本文主要介绍Python中,pandas dataframe的iloc 和 loc 的用法及区别,以及相关的示例代码。 原文地址:Python pandas dataframe iloc 和 loc 的用法及区别
转载
2022-06-02 07:01:24
455阅读
文章目录1.条件筛选1.1 单条件筛选1.2 多条件筛选1.3 排除特定行2. 索引筛选2.1 切片操作2.2 loc函数2.3 iloc2.4 ix函数2.5 at函数2.6 iat函数 众所周知pandas的DataFrame数据结构提供了功能强大的数据操作功能,例如运算,筛选,统计等。 今
转载
2022-02-23 17:24:26
1408阅读
文章目录1.条件筛选1.1 单条件筛选1.2 多条件筛选1.3 排除特定行2. 索引筛选2.1 切片操作2.2 loc函数2.3 iloc2.4 ix函数2.5 at函数2.6 iat函数众所周知pandas的DataFrame数据结构提供了功能强大的数据操作功能,例如运算,筛选,统计等。今天我们就来谈一谈其强大的数据筛选功能,主要包括两大类,按照条件筛选和按照索引筛选。可以对行进行筛选,也可...
转载
2021-06-18 14:12:21
4016阅读
共同点两者都接收两个参数,第一个参数是行的范围,第二个参数是列的范围不同点
loc函数接收的是行/列的名称,iloc函数接收的是行/列的下标(从0开始)
loc函数在切片时是按闭区间切片的,也就是区间两边都能取到,iloc函数则是按传统的左闭右开的方式切片的图解:详细用法用于展示用法的数据data如下:loc函数参数类型单个行名/列名 或 行名/列名的列表print(data.loc['Chris
转载
2023-10-19 12:10:04
449阅读
pandas中索引的使用定义一个pandas的DataFrame对像import pandas as pddata = pd.DataFrame({'A':[1,2,3],'B':[4,5,6],'C':[7,8,9]},index=["a","b","c"])data A B Ca 1 4 7b 2 5 8c 3 6 9...
原创
2022-02-23 17:57:43
153阅读
行选取:选取 0-12 的索引行,输入"0:13"列想要全部选取,则输入冒号“:”即可。 列选取:只想查看流量来源和客单价:1、行全部选取,输入冒号":"2、流量来源是第 1 列,客单价是第 5 列,对应的列索引分别是 0 和 4 注:跨列索引得先把位置参数构造成列表形式,这里就是 [0,4],如果是连续选取,则无需构造成列表,直接输入 0:5行列交叉选取:查看二
原创
2023-10-11 10:14:52
124阅读
df = pd.DataFrame(np.arange(4).reshape(2, -1))
pd.concat([df, df.iloc[[0]]]) # df.iloc[[i]] ~ df
pd.concat([df, df.iloc[0]]) # df.iloc[i] ~ series
原创
2023-12-22 09:03:59
115阅读
python中iloc和loc的用法loc:标签索引iloc:位置索引 近期学习到了loc和iloc的切片用法,发现用法实在是很多,所以用一个简单的例子进行总结用法,期间也借鉴了大量笔记,如果有错误的地方,期待小伙伴们评论区指正。 pandas以类似字典的方式来获取某一列的值。 数据data.csv分布如下: 查看数据:import pandas as pd
data = pd.read_cs
转载
2023-10-23 09:50:05
205阅读